Schraw, Gregory – Journal of Experimental Education, 1997
The basis of students' confidence in their answers to test items was studied with 95 undergraduates. Results support the domain-general hypothesis that predicts that confidence judgments will be related to performance on a particular test and also to confidence judgments and performance on unrelated tests.
